    Does the photovoltaic inverter need ventilation holes

    Yes, an inverter absolutely needs ventilation because it produces heat during operation that must be dissipated to maintain safety, efficiency, and longevity. The ventilation requirements for a solar inverter depend on its size, design, and the manufacturer's specifications. Inverters generate significant heat and must be installed in a cool, dry, and well-ventilated area to allow for effective heat dissipation. In all Sungrow installation guides and manuals, a recommended ventilation space around the equipment is included in the installation instructions. However, different sites may have different circumstances, and the dimensions may be changed.

    No need to drill holes on the roof of photovoltaic bracket

    Fortunately, advances in solar technology and racking design have made it possible to mount solar panels securely without the need for drilling. One of the most common alternatives is ballasted mounting systems, often used on flat roofs. Attaching solar panels to a roof without drilling is not only possible but also a preferred method for preserving roof integrity and aesthetics. Below, we explore practical. Drilling holes can create long-term issues such as leaks, weakened roofing materials, or complicated repairs in the future.
